Understanding Global Data Analytics

At its core, global data analytics involves the examination, modeling, and interpretation of large and complex data sets to discover meaningful patterns and trends. This process leverages advanced statistical methods, machine learning algorithms, and data visualization techniques to extract actionable insights.

The Role of Big Data

The foundation of global data analytics lies in big data. With the exponential growth of data generated from various sources—such as social media, IoT devices, and transactional databases—organizations are now able to harness this vast reservoir of information. By analyzing big data, companies can uncover hidden insights that drive strategic decisions and enhance operational efficiency.

Applications of Global Data Analytics

The applications of global data analytics are vast and varied, spanning numerous industries. Here are some key areas where data analytics is making a significant impact:

Healthcare

In the healthcare sector, global data analytics is revolutionizing patient care and medical research. By analyzing patient data, hospitals can identify trends, predict disease outbreaks, and personalize treatment plans. For example, predictive analytics can help in forecasting patient admissions and optimizing resource allocation.

Finance

The financial industry is leveraging global data analytics to enhance fraud detection, risk management, and customer insights. Banks and financial institutions use data analytics to identify suspicious transactions, assess credit risk, and develop targeted marketing strategies. This not only improves operational efficiency but also strengthens regulatory compliance.

Retail

Retailers are utilizing global data analytics to understand customer behavior, optimize inventory management, and drive sales. By analyzing purchasing patterns and preferences, retailers can offer personalized recommendations, improve supply chain logistics, and enhance the overall customer experience.

Future Trends in Global Data Analytics

As technology continues to evolve, the future of global data analytics holds exciting possibilities. Here are some emerging trends shaping the landscape:

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ning

The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) into data analytics is transforming the way organizations process and interpret data. These advanced technologies enable more accurate predictions, automate complex tasks, and uncover deeper insights from vast datasets.

Real-Time Analytics

Real-time analytics is becoming increasingly important as businesses seek to respond quickly to changing market conditions. By processing data in real-time, organizations can make timely decisions, monitor performance metrics, and adjust strategies on the fly.

Cloud-Based Analytics

The adoption of cloud-based analytics solutions is on the rise, offering scalability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ness. Cloud platforms provide powerful tools for data storage, processing, and analysis, enabling organizations to leverage advanced analytics without significant upfront investment.

Real-World Examples

To illustrate the impact of global data analytics, let's look at a few real-world examples:

Netflix

Netflix uses global data analytics to recommend content to its users based on their viewing history and preferences. By analyzing vast amounts of data, Netflix can suggest personalized shows and movies, enhancing user engagement and satisfaction.

Amazon

Amazon employs global data analytics to optimize its supply chain, manage inventory, and personalize the shopping experience for its customers. By leveraging data insights, Amazon can predict demand, streamline operations, and offer tailored recommendations.

Walmart

Walmart utilizes global data analytics to understand customer behavior, manage inventory, and improve supply chain efficiency. By analyzing sales data and customer trends, Walmart can make informed decisions to enhance its operations and deliver better value to its customers.
